What is a CLS Trainee?
What is the difference between Cls Trainee vs Cls Technician?
| Aspect | Cls Trainee | Cls Technician |
|---|---|---|
| Credentials | Typically requires a high school diploma or equivalent; training programs provided | Requires certification or diploma in clinical laboratory science or related field |
| Work Environment | Training setting, supervised by experienced staff | Independent work in laboratories, performing tests and analyses |
| Employer & Industry | Hospitals, clinics, diagnostic labs during training | Diagnostic labs, hospitals, research facilities |
| Common Search & Comparison | Often compared during career planning or entry-level job searches | Compared for career advancement or certification purposes |
The main difference between a Cls Trainee and a Cls Technician is that the trainee is in a learning phase, often undergoing supervised training, while the technician is a qualified professional performing laboratory tests independently. The trainee focuses on gaining skills, whereas the technician applies those skills in a work setting.

Arrowhead Regional Medical Center (ARMC) is recruiting for Clinical Laboratory Scientists I and II who perform a wide variety of analytic laboratory procedures and apply laboratory policies and processes in the areas of Chemistry, Serology, Hematology, Coagulation, Urinalysis, Blood Bank and Microbiology. Visit to learn more about ARMC's
Clinical Laboratory Scientists I are considered Trainees and are eligible for promotion to Clinical Laboratory Scientist II upon receipt of a satisfactory work performance evaluation. Incumbents must promote within twelve (12) months or be terminated.
For more detailed information, refer to the Clinical Laboratory Scientist I job description.
Clinical Laboratory Scientists II are considered the Journey-level classification to the CLS series and require the ability to recognize a range of reactions including deviation from the norm.

Minimum Requirements
CLINICAL LABORATORY SCIENTIST I
OPTION 1 - LICENSURE
- Must possess and maintain a Clinical Laboratory Scientist (CLS) license issued by the State of California, Department of Public Health. A limited license is not considered qualifying; license must have the "MTA" prefix.
NOTE:If applying under this option, candidates must provide their CLS License number and expiration date in the Supplemental Questionnaire of the online application.
OPTION 2 - EDUCATION & PRE-LICENSURE
- Graduation from a CDPH approved CLS training program AND eligibilityto sit for the CDPH approved certification examination for California CLS licensure.
NOTE:Candidates applying under this option must attach proof of successful completion of an approved CDPH CLS training program and eligibility to sit for California CLS licensure to their online application.
-OR-
- Students currently enrolled in Arrowhead Regional Medical Center's Clinical Laboratory Scientist Program that are one month (30 days) from successfully graduating are eligible to apply.
NOTE:Candidates applying under this option must attach a letter or notice from their Program Director that indicates they are in good standing in the program and are on-track to graduating within one month (30 days). This option is exclusive to ARMC students and does not apply to students enrolled in programs outside of ARMC.
CLINICAL LABORATORY SCIENTIST II
Candidates must possess the following License and Experience:
LICENSE: Must possess and maintain a Clinical Laboratory Scientist (CLS) license issued by the State of California, Department of Public Health.
NOTE: A limited license is not considered qualifying; license must have the "MTA" prefix.
EXPERIENCE: One (1) year of full-time experience as a Clinical Laboratory Scientist.
Desired Qualifications
Applicants with training from a National Accrediting Agency for Clinical Laboratory Sciences (NAACLS) approved institution are desired.
